7 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Inconstant'
His inconstant mood swings were difficult for his friends to understand.
The inconstant behavior of the machine indicated a potential malfunction.
The inconstant performance of the team disappointed their loyal fans.
The inconstant weather in this region makes it challenging to plan outdoor events.
Sarah's inconstant mood swings have been affecting her relationships with friends.
The inconstant buzzing sound from the faulty electronics was irritating.
Inconstant internet connectivity is a common issue in rural areas.
